WebThe question of which of the four steps of cellular respiration occur in the mitochondria can, if necessary, be answered by a process of elimination: Even prokaryotes carry out glycolysis, and they lack mitochondria, where the bridge reaction, the Krebs cycle and the electron transport chain occur.
